Job Description

JOB TITLE: ProductionSupervisor Day Shift
DEPARTMENT: Packaging Facility - Downtown Frankfort (1123 Main Street building)
REPORTS TO: Plant Manager
Job Summary:
This position is responsible for providing supervision and guidance to all hourly production workers working within the Main Street Packaging Facility. This includes coordinating hourly worker schedules supervising the manufacturing of goods and ensuring all workers adhere to corporate policies and addition they should be able to operate all production equipment and assist in troubleshooting operating issues.
Deliverables:
Consistently meet or exceed production and/or packaging targets through the effective use of appropriate personnel in the various operation processes.
Job Duties:
  • Ensures all employees follow policies and procedures in accordance with Safety and Legality.
  • Validate the work of subordinate employees and ensure daily tasks are completed.
  • Manage the setup and completion of production jobs according to a defined schedule.
  • Ensure inventory of materials and finished goods is accurate and available for production.
  • Assist in identifying problems related to production process and work to resolve issues.
  • Suggests improvements to process to reduce waste and increase productivity.
  • Conducts risk assessments identifying and eliminating potential safety hazards in the plant.
  • Good understanding of all Manufacturing equipment and able to train production employees.
  • Ensures training records are maintained and available.
  • Coordinate and approve hourly employee PTO and Sick time.
  • Manage and submit timecard data for payroll.
  • Assists in the documentation preparation and delivery of employee discipline.
  • Authors procedures and work instructions to document Standard Work.
  • Manages key projects as directed by the Plant Manager.
Education and Qualifications:
  • 5 years of leadership in a Manufacturing environment.
  • Proven track record of leadership and capable mentor.
  • Food Industry and HACCP/PCQI experience preferred.
  • Excellent interpersonal computer and communications skills (both verbal and written).
  • Be a self-starter who works with a sense of urgency and acts as a good team player working with other disciplines.
